Clapham Property Types and Common Moving Challenges
One reason people look specifically for a Clapham removal van or moving van service is that local property layouts can be challenging. Clapham has a wide mix of homes and business spaces, each with its own access issues. Understanding those differences helps you choose the right service and prepare properly.
Converted period buildings, especially those with split-level flats or tight staircases, can make moving more demanding. Modern apartment blocks may have lift restrictions, booking systems, or limited loading zones. Terraced homes can have limited frontage and narrow streets. Shared houses often mean coordinating around several people and their belongings, which can slow things down if the process is not planned carefully.
Commercial premises around Clapham also need consideration. Offices, studios, clinics, retail spaces, and hospitality businesses often require moving work outside busy customer hours. A van service that understands local timing and access can help reduce disruption and make the transfer more efficient for everyone involved.
Typical Local Access Issues
- Controlled parking restrictions and permit-only streets
- Narrow roads or tight turning space near residential blocks
- Shared entrances and limited corridor width
- Lift booking rules in larger buildings
- Busy traffic times on main routes
- Limited loading time for commercial or residential properties

What Affects the Price of a Moving Van in Clapham?
Because every move is different, pricing usually depends on several practical factors rather than one fixed figure. Customers often want to know what influences the cost so they can plan ahead and compare options fairly. Understanding the key variables also helps you decide whether you need a smaller local transport job or a fuller moving service.
Common pricing factors include the size of the load, the distance travelled, the time required for loading and unloading, and how complex the access is at each property. A top-floor flat with limited parking will naturally take more time and planning than a ground-floor collection with easy roadside access.
Other factors may include the number of items requiring careful handling, whether the move involves waiting time, whether multiple stops are needed, and whether the job takes place at a busy time of day. Customers should always provide as much detail as possible to help shape an accurate quote.
Factors That Can Influence the Quote
- Volume and weight of the items
- Distance between pickup and delivery points
- Number of floors and lift access
- Parking and loading restrictions
- Need for extra handling or special care
- Timing, urgency, and number of stops

Preparation Checklist Before the Van Arrives
A well-prepared move is usually a smoother move. Even when you have professional help, there are a few things you can do in advance to make loading and unloading faster. These small steps can save time and reduce the chance of damage or confusion.
Preparing well is especially important in Clapham, where access can sometimes be limited by parking pressure or building layout. The more organised your items are before the van arrives, the less time is spent on avoidable delays.
Useful Pre-Move Checklist
- Pack and seal boxes before moving day
- Separate valuables and documents
- Defrost fridges and freezers in advance if needed
- Disassemble furniture where practical
- Reserve or confirm parking if possible
- Protect floors and doorways if required by your building
- Keep a bag of essentials for the first night
It can also help to label items by room so unloading at the other end is faster. If you have delicate possessions, mark them clearly and mention them at the booking stage so they can be handled appropriately.
